State Bans Salmon Fishing On Most Inland Rivers
MONTEREY (CBS13) ―
It's official. California's Fish And Game Commission is banning nearly all salmon sport fishing in Central Valley rivers.
The commission voted today in Monterey to ban Salmon fishing on parts of the Sacramento, San Joaquin and American Rivers.
Salmon fishing has already been banned off the coast of California. That ban which goes from the coastline to three miles out went into effect in April.
The coastal fishing ban is already expected to cause a $200 million loss in California as well as 2,000 jobs.
